Education & Training Grants & Funding

There are 1660 UK funders offering grants for education & training charities, with typical awards from £100 to £1,000,000.

Education and training grants represent one of the largest categories in UK charitable funding. Funders in this space support everything from early childhood literacy programmes to adult skills retraining, with particular emphasis on closing attainment gaps for disadvantaged learners. Many trusts fund supplementary education — after-school clubs, tutoring, mentoring, and enrichment activities — that complement statutory provision. STEM education, digital literacy, and vocational training have attracted growing funder interest as the UK skills gap continues to widen. Arts education, outdoor learning, and sport-based engagement programmes also receive significant support. Several major foundations focus specifically on higher education access, providing bursaries and scholarships for students from low-income backgrounds. Grant-makers in this area typically value measurable outcomes such as improved attainment, qualification completion rates, and progression into employment. Collaborative projects between schools, colleges, and community organisations are particularly well-regarded.

Tips for Applying to Education & Training Funders

Education funders expect clear, measurable learning outcomes in your application. Define specific targets such as reading age improvements, qualification attainment rates, or skills acquisition benchmarks, and explain how you will track progress against them. Reference any quality marks, Ofsted ratings, or accreditation your organisation holds — these signal credibility and rigour to grant-makers. Present your cost-per-learner or cost-per-outcome figures to demonstrate value for money, as education funders are particularly focused on efficient use of resources. Show clear progression routes for participants: how does your programme connect to the next stage of their learning or employment journey rather than operating in isolation? If your training leads to recognised qualifications or certifications, highlight this prominently. Demonstrate alignment with national curriculum standards or sector-specific frameworks where relevant, and explain how your approach fills gaps that mainstream provision does not address. Strong applications show evidence of what works — reference pilot data, external evaluations, or published research that supports your methodology. Include partnerships with schools, colleges, employers, or sector bodies that validate your approach and create pathways for learners beyond your programme.
